asf-mode
Enable alternate store and forward (ASF) mode and forward packets as soon as a threshold is reached.
Syntax
asf-mode stack-unit {unit-id | all} queue size
To return to standard Store and Forward mode, use the no asf-mode command.
Parameters
unit-id
Enter the stack member unit identier of the stack member to reset. The S4810 range is from 0 to 11.
NOTE: The S4810 commands accept Unit ID numbers from 0 to 11, though S4810 supports
stacking of up to six units.
queue size Enter the queue size of the stack member. The range is from 0 to 15.
